April 8, 2006
LEXINGTON, SC - The UMES Lady Hawks took an early 3-0 lead over defending MEAC champions Bethune-Cookman (BCC) but the Lady Wildcats battled back to take the 11-3 victory on day two of the MEAC Roundup at Pine Grove Complex. UMES (3-26, 0-10 MEAC) forged ahead in the first inning. Charlotte Ngondi led off the inning with a single up the middle and Latoya Bailey followed when she reached on an error by the second baseman. Kendra Saunders plated all three runs for the Lady Hawks when she homered to center field to send Ngondi and Bailey home. BCC (24-23, 8-3 MEAC) put up two runs in the bottom first when Ariel Robinson and Shaterra Davis each crossed the plate for the Lady Wildcats. Bethune-Cookman plated two more in the second and scored seven runs on six hits in the third, en route to an 11-3 lead. Saunders finished 2-2 with one run and three RBI's. Ngondi went 2-3 with one run, while Bailey and Jenille Edwards each picked up a hit for UMES. The Lady Wildcats had a 3-3 outing from Robinson to go along with two runs and two RBI's. The Lady Hawks return to action tomorrow when they battle first-place Florida A&M (FAMU) in the third day of the conference roundup. UMES, originally scheduled to play the Lady Rattlers at 2:00 pm on Saturday, will instead play at 9:00 am Sunday due to inclement weather in the Lexington area.
